Should US have dropped the atomic bombs on Japan?

At the ending stages of World War 2, the US dropped the atomic bombs, Little Boy, upon Hiroshima on 6 August 1945, and Fat Man upon Nagasaki on 9 August 1945, in a bid to bring the war to an end as quickly as possible. Till today, there had been numerous debate about this issue, and whether the atomic bombs should have been used to end the war. Personally, I agree with the US's action to drop the atomic bombs on Japan, as otherwise, there would have been more casualties, and Japan would have fought to the last, causing the war to be dragged on for much longer, prolonging the suffering of the both the prisoners and the civilians caught in the war. Also, for the US, it was preferable for the Japanese to die rather than its own citizens. Therefore, due to the reasons stated above, the US dropped the atomic bombs on Japan.
